Key Travel Distance
When it comes to key travel distance, you might be surprised by how much this little factor can shape your whole typing experience! Key travel distance is simply how far a key moves down when you press it. Short travel—around 1-2mm—is perfect if you want lightning-fast typing with less finger fatigue. Imagine typing on fluffy pillows, but faster!
Prefer a classic vibe? Keys traveling 3-4mm give you that satisfying “click-clack” feel, like an old-school typewriter dance party. Plus, the right travel distance helps keep your wrists comfy—reducing strain over long sessions. Some keyboards even let you adjust travel distance! Actuation Force Required
You’ve got key travel distance down, but did you know how much the pressure you use when typing changes everything? Actuation force is the push needed to register a keystroke. It can range from a feather-light 30g to a sturdy 80g! Want to type faster? Lighter forces, about 45g, can speed you up. Prefer feeling every press? Heavier forces, like 60g or more, give that satisfying “click” and stop accidental taps.
Here’s a quick tip: think about how long you type each day. Heavy force might tire your fingers! So, try a lighter or medium actuation force to keep your hands comfy over time. Picking the right force is like Goldilocks—find what feels just right for you!
Switch Type Impact
Since the switch type plays a huge role in how your keyboard feels, it’s worth getting to know your options! Mechanical switches, like Cherry MX, come in tactile, linear, and clicky flavors. Each offers a different touch experience—like your own personal typing playlist!
Want fast, light keystrokes? Go for lighter switches. Prefer more resistance to avoid accidental typing? Heavier switches are your friends. Plus, mechanical switches often last over 50 million presses—that’s a LOT of emails and memes!
Don’t forget features like N-Key rollover and anti-ghosting, which make sure every key you hit actually registers, even when you’re a lightning-fast typer. Choosing the right switch is like picking your keyboard soulmate—make it count!

Noise Level Consideration
Picking the right keyboard isn’t just about how it feels under your fingers—it’s also about how much noise it makes! Imagine typing away and suddenly everyone in the room jumps—yep, a clicky mechanical keyboard can do that. Mechanical switches can get loud, some reaching up to 80 dB—that’s like a busy street! Meanwhile, rubber dome or scissor-switch keyboards are much quieter, often below 50 dB, perfect for shared spaces or quiet offices.
